Frequently asked questions

What is Cabrini Terrace Owners Corp's energy grade?

Cabrini Terrace Owners Corp scores 77 out of 100 on ENERGY STAR — band B (Above median (70–84)) — in its 2024 New York City disclosure. Scores are national percentiles against similar buildings; 75+ qualifies for ENERGY STAR certification.

How much energy does Cabrini Terrace Owners Corp use?

Its 2024 site energy-use intensity was 72.6 kBtu/ft² (101.9 kBtu/ft² source) across 236,664 sq ft, including 1,017,708 kWh of electricity and 137,020 therms of natural gas.

What are Cabrini Terrace Owners Corp's carbon emissions?

Cabrini Terrace Owners Corp reported 1,127 tCO₂e of greenhouse-gas emissions (4.8 kgCO₂e/ft²) for 2024. Under Local Law 97, buildings over 25,000 sq ft face carbon caps with fines of $268 per metric ton of CO₂e over the limit, phasing in from 2024.
